January 21st is Bell’s “Let’s Talk” Day. This is a great opportunity not just to participate in their initiative, but to take some time to learn more about why mental health is so important and worth investing in.

On their website, Bell writes, “In September 2010, we launched the Bell Let’s Talk mental health initiative, the largest corporate commitment to mental health in Canada focused on 4 key action pillars: fighting the stigma, improving access to care, supporting world class research and leading by example in workplace mental health. Since then, Bell Let’s Talk has committed more than $139 million to Canadian mental health initiatives.”
